12 Sep 2024

Mogwai’s Stuart Braithwaite: Stargazing, Aliens & Looking back

From Music 101 Interviews, 5:00 pm on 12 September 2024

Stuart Braithwaite of cult Scottish band Mogwai talks stargazing with his Dad, playing so loud the ceiling caved in, and the making of the band's new documentary.